How do we talk about rape?
from The Gender Knot · host Nastaran Tavakoli-Far
Author of the book ‘Rape’ Mithu Sanyal fills us in on ways we can approach talking about rape and giving support, and why consent culture is tricky in societies where we are taught not to express our needs and desires clearly in the first place.
